help with development kit - csantmail - Oct 29 15:50:00 2003

Hi,

I would like to buy an AVR development kit WITH ALL the things that I
need to develop some new projects. If that kit has a C compiler,
that would be great.

The first project that I have to develop needs communication to 2
serial devices (RS232) and a few parallel input/outputs, and I would
need the kit mainly to develop this project.

Thank you in advance.

Carlos

RE: Re: [AVR club] help with development kit - Nimni, Yosef - Oct 29 16:27:00 2003

Carlos,
The C compiler line-up is:
1. GNU GCC Compiler ( free)
2. Imagecraft C - http://www.imagecraft.com/software/
<http://www.imagecraft.com/software/>
3. Code vision - http://www.delcomp.com/indexcv.htm
<http://www.delcomp.com/indexcv.htm>
4. IAR ( expensive) - http://www.iar.com <http://www.iar.com>
Which one to use? it is up to you. Look at cost and support. I have found
out that many are using the first three.

The STK501 works with the STK500 and support the parts that have 2 UARTS (
like the mega64 and mega128).
Y.
